How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 10th and Page?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
10th and Page Studio Apartments | $1,647 | $1,409 | $1,946 |
10th and Page 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,870 | $895 | $4,101 |
10th and Page 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,504 | $835 | $4,732 |
10th and Page 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,160 | $4,928 | $5,393 |
10th and Page 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,652 | $1,289 | $5,360 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 10th and Page
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 10th and Page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 10th and Page ranges from $895 to $4,101 with an average monthly rent of $1,870.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 10th and Page c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 10th and Page range from $835 to $4,732.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,504.
